336 | A Borchardt C 93 by Loewe, in case, circa 1898 Cal. 7,65mmBorchardt, SN. 1559, matching numbers. Barrel length 190 mm, almost bright bore. Eight shots. German proof marks Crown over “BUG”. The toggle link marked “D.R.P. No 75887”, the right side of the receiver “SYSTEM BORCHARDT. PAT- ENT. / DEUTSCHE WAFFEN- UND MUNITIONSFABRIKEN. / BERLIN.”. The original finish with thinning at the grip straps and the base of the front sight. Holster wear on the edges, signs of shoulder stock mounting. Small parts partly fire blued, partly case hardened. The walnut grips almost flawless. A magazine not numbered to the gun is insert- ed. Very good overall condition. Accessories: three spare magazines numbered to the gun (can’t tell if original or re-numbered), original shoulder stock with signs of wear, wooden handle, detachable screw driver blades, clean- ing rod, steel punches. The black leather holster attached to the stock and the leather sling are reproductions. Erlaubnispflichtig. 288537 I - € 8.900
